TitleCopy letter from Herbert Rix, to Lord Kelvin [William Thomson], Fellow of the Royal Society
Date21 March 1893
DescriptionRix supposes the enclosed letter [not attached] from Mr Joule, should come before the next Council, but he sends it on as Thomson may wish to reply to it personally.

Rix imagines there is no doubt about the acceptance of the bust, but there may be some doubt about the acceptance of the apparatus, as they have no very convenient place at the Society for keeping it. Rix imagines it would be better to say nothing either way until the Council has been consulted.
